11 December 2023 became a historic day for the sovereignty of India and the state of Jammu and Kashmir. On this day, a five-judge Constitution bench of the Supreme Court upheld the decision to remove Articles 370 and 35A from Jammu and Kashmir and said that it was a temporary section which had to be removed sooner or later. A bench headed by Chief Justice DY Chandrachud said that Article 370 was a temporary arrangement. The court said that the Constitution of India is superior to the Constitution of Jammu and Kashmir and neutralization of Article 370 has strengthened the process of integration of Jammu and Kashmir with India. Justice Chandrachud said that the removal of Section 370 is constitutionally valid and the decision of the Central Government is absolutely right.

The Supreme Court has made many important and historical observations in its decision in which it has been said that after the signing of the Instrument of Accession, Jammu and Kashmir has no element of sovereignty. There is no internal sovereignty for Jammu and Kashmir. The exercise of the President’s power must have proper relation to the purpose of the President’s rule. The Court has made it clear that when the Constituent Assembly was dissolved, only the temporary power of the Assembly ceased and there was no restriction on the orders of the President. The exercise of power by the President was not malicious and did not require any consent with the State. The continued exercise of power by the President shows that the process of unification was ongoing and thus invalidates CO 273. The Constitution of Jammu and Kashmir is operative and has been declared null and void. Chief Justice Chandrachud said that statehood will be restored to Jammu and Kashmir and we maintain the decision to separate Ladakh. The Supreme Court finally said that we direct the Election Commission to conduct elections by 30 September 2024 under the Reorganization Act and Section 14 of the State Register.

The court has also given an order that a committee should be formed to investigate all types of terrorist/migration incidents that took place in the state after 1980, which is a very important thing and opens the way for Kashmiri Pandits to get justice. After the introduction of this system, the incidents that took place against Kashmiri Pandits in the valley after 1980 can now be investigated. This bench of the Supreme Court was headed by Chief Justice DY Chandrachud and the bench included Justice Sanjay Kishan Kaul, Justice Sanjeev Khanna, Justice BR Gavai and Justice Surya Kant.

Justice Kaul’s historical comment

In his judgment on Article 370 in Jammu and Kashmir, Justice Sanjay Kishan Kaul, while referring to the exodus of Kashmiri Pandits, said that he has suggested forming a Truth and Reconciliation Commission to investigate the human rights violations that have taken place in the state since 1980. He said that this commission will not work like a criminal investigation commission. Justice Kaul believes that the women, children and men of the state have suffered a lot due to terrorism. There is a need to forget this and heal the wounds to move forward. Developing a collective understanding of the human rights violations committed against the people here by the state and extra-state actors would be the first impartial effort towards healing. They can be compensated to a great extent with the help of the Commission.

It is noteworthy that after the bill related to removal of Articles 370 and 35A presented by Home Minister Amit Shah was passed by both the Houses of Parliament on August 5, 2019, people like dynastic leaders of Jammu and Kashmir state Farooq Abdullah and Mehbooba Mufti and many other organizations The Supreme Court was approached against this. This historic decision has come after 16 days of hearing on their petitions between August and September, on which all the countrymen and political parties including separatist leaders and Pakistan were keeping an eye on.
